Ethical Trade Assistant Manager

Job Description

To support and assist the continuous development of the Next plc global CR strategy and to maintain/improve the compliance of Next plc supply chain sources. This will involve identifying where issues exist, making decisions and reporting on the improvements required, and managing such action plans to achieve the required standards

Key Responsibilities

Auditing

  • Ensuring that the new supplier onboarding/induction process is followed
  • Processing New Site Requests (NSR) and factory self-assessments for inclusion in audit planning
  • Complete a risk analysis prior to auditing, based on factory self-assessment
  • Scheduling audits as per Code of Practice (COP) team audit plan
  • Planning and organising of new and follow up audits in designated region, coordinated with global team as needed
  • Carry out COP audits in UK & Rest of World region in line with COP Principle Standards and Auditing Standards, produce audit reports, and distribute to relevant parties as per departmental timelines(see supplementary document)
  • Ensuring that non-conformities are clearly identified & communicated to the relevant supplier in a timely manner
  • Maintaining the departmental audit system (known as SCOP) with site and audit information

COP Process

  • Plan and hold Product Team meetings covering a range of issues such as factory lists, compliance performance, remediation plans, global supply chain issues
  • Plan and hold Product Division Director and Manager meetings
  • Supporting suppliers/factories/product teams/global COP team with management of corrective action plans
  • Build and maintain supplier relationships (see supplementary document)
  • Management of severe non-conformities (Cat 4-6), including unauthorised subcontracting, at factories in your designated division; liaising with relevant product teams and global COP team colleagues to ensure appropriate action is taken and internal records are maintained.
  • Completion of departmental admin support tasks e.g. supplier access to Next systems and tracking of contracts to confirm factory information is provided by suppliers
  • Developing and delivering internal training for product teams
  • Engagement with internal teams on business changes affecting the department e.g. IT systems development

Reports

  • Analysis of contract assigning reports to track suppliers who are not providing accurate supply chain information. Liaise with suppliers who have not assigned factories to contracts according to business requirements.
  • Attend and contribute relevant updates to COP UK team meetings, ensuring awareness of current issues, activities, and progress
  • Analysis of divisional data from monthly COP reports to identify areas for improvement
